22 MILLION WOULD LOSE INSURANCE: CT Dems’ Statement On CBO Trumpcare Score

Hartford, Ct. – Connecticut Democratic Party Chairman Nick Balletto released the following statement.

“This Trumpcare bill is an absolute disaster, and it needs to be stopped. There is no excuse for passing a bill that would strip health insurance from millions of working people, children, people facing addictions, seniors, and middle class families — all to give a massive tax cut to the wealthiest 1%.

“In Connecticut, health care access for 724,000 people who have gained insurance through the Affordable Care Act — including 217,000 who benefited from the Medicaid expansion — is now threatened.
